Lyophilisation is a complex freeze-drying process that removes water from a biological or chemical sample while preserving its molecular structure. We supply our peptides as lyophilised powders because it vastly increases their stability and structural integrity during transit and storage.
Reconstitution is a standard laboratory technique where lyophilised (freeze-dried) powder is dissolved in a suitable solvent to create a liquid solution for analytical testing. This process is commonly employed in research laboratories when working with peptide reference standards, proteins, and other biomolecules that are supplied in lyophilised form for stability during storage and transport. The choice of solvent, concentration, and handling procedures are determined by the specific requirements of each research protocol and analytical method. Before reconstitution (while still in lyophilised powder form), vials should be stored away from direct sunlight. For long-term preservation of molecular integrity, we recommend storing lyophilised vials in a designated laboratory freezer at -20°C. For short-term storage, a dedicated laboratory refrigerator at 2°C to 8°C is acceptable.
